Jeffrey Uhlmann

Dr. Uhlmann is ranked in the top 2% among scientists worldwide in the Stanford University listing of most-cited researchers.

[5] He served for ten years as a co-founding member of the editorial board of the ACM Journal of Experimental Algorithmics (1995–2006) before becoming co-editor of the Synthesis Lectures on Quantum Computing series for Morgan & Claypool.

[6] Uhlmann published seminal papers on volumetric, spatial, and metric tree data structures and their applications for computer graphics, virtual reality, and multiple-target tracking.

[10] Uhlmann's results are widely-applied in tracking, navigation, and control systems, including for the NASA Mars rover program.

[11][12] His results relating to the constrained shortest path problem and simultaneous localization and mapping are also used in rover and autonomous vehicle applications.
